Changed defaults, on-call folks, so read this one. The loyalty-points ledger now batches accrual writes every 500ms instead of per-transaction, which cuts write load roughly 60% but means balances can lag by up to a second. Alerts tuned accordingly — don't panic at small transient mismatches between the ledger and the rewards cache; they self-heal. Reversals still apply synchronously. If a batch flush fails three times, the service halts accruals and pages you. The new defaults ship as the following configuration values.

settings of hagug-fawip:
BRIWYN_LOG_LEVEL=warn
BRIWYN_METRICS_HOST=metrics.briwyn.qorvelsys.internal
BRIWYN_POOL_SIZE=8

**Internal Memo — Reseller Programme Handover**

For the incoming director: the Stratlane reseller programme currently covers fourteen partners across three regions. Margins are tiered at 15–25% by volume, reviewed annually. Two partners are on performance watch following missed Q2 targets. Onboarding materials were refreshed last month and await your sign-off. A note on where we intend to take the programme follows below.

internal memo for kawip-hadug: Headcount on the Wenwyn team goes from 7 to 140 by the end of January. Gross margin on Wenwyn came in at 20 percent against a plan of 15 percent.

## Sensor drift: what to do at 3am

If the GrowLoop controller starts reporting humidity swings that don't match the backup probes in the Fernwick greenhouse, it's almost always sensor drift, not an actual climate event. Don't panic and don't touch the vents manually. First, restart the calibration daemon and give it ten minutes to re-baseline. If readings still disagree by more than 5%, flip the controller into safe mode. The safe-mode thresholds it will use are these.

config for yahap-bajof:
[istix]
host = istix.qorvelsys.internal
user = istix_svc
database = istix_prod

## Further Reading

Before modifying the checkout load tests, review how Cartwheel's staged ramp profiles were calibrated against the Feldspar payment sandbox. The soak-test thresholds assume a warm cache and three replicas; changing either invalidates prior baselines. Historical runs, annotated flame graphs, and the rationale for our 95th-percentile targets are collected on the internal results page.

dashboard of yahaf-kajep = https://jira.zemvarsys.internal/display/projects/browse/browse/a08b